Jumping Branch Elementary School
School Overview
Jumping Branch Elementary School is a public school located in Jumping Branch, West Virginia. It is a school in Summers County School District district.
According to the West Virginia state assessment result, about 34% of students are proficient in Math learning .
It has 119 students through grade PK to 5. The students to teacher ratio is 13 to 1 where a total of 9 teachers are teaching for the school.

Teachers & Staffs
Total 9 full-time (or equivalent) teachers work for Jumping Branch Elementary School and the students to teacher ratio is 13 to 1. All teachers are certified. 77.8% of teachers have 3 or more years teaching experiences.
